Vermilion City Gym (Japanese: ) is a Stadium card. It is part of the Gym Heroes set.

Card text

This card stays in play when you play it. Discard this card if another Stadium card comes into play.

Whenever a player attacks a Pokémon with Lt. Surge in its name, he or she may flip a coin. If heads, and if that Pokémon's attack does damage to the Defending Pokémon (after applying Weakness and Resistance), that attack does 10 more damage to the Defending Pokémon. If tails, the attacking Pokémon does 10 damage to itself in addition to whatever its attack usually does.
